Greetings!
Asking for help any modder who knows. I have an autospell (spell casts over numerous targets on battlefield) with really big amount of targets (~50) and when I'm casting this spell camera moves fast and shakes like crazy. When I use effect delay then spell animation plays too slow.

Any tips?
 
On the Auto Spell object, have you tried changing the values under the "Shake Parameters" and "Camera Focus Settings" sections?

I don't know if those affect what you're seeing, but they seem like they might since the Tilt Angle setting for the camera is set differently for the defensive structure's auto spells.
 
On the Auto Spell object, have you tried changing the values under the "Shake Parameters" and "Camera Focus Settings" sections?

"Shake Parameters" are disabled, so I didn't even check it. I also tried different combinations in "Camera Focus Settings", but I didn't see much difference.
I'm interested is there any options to turn off camera focusing on units completely?
